Subject: Quickstore 4.2 — bloom filter now fronts the KV layer

Plugin authors: starting with this release, Quickstore places a bloom filter ahead of the key-value store. Negative lookups return faster; false positives fall through safely. No API changes are required on your side. Verify your plugin against the staging build referenced below.

session token of fahif-tadup = htk3_9c7

The Farebridge dynamic-pricing experiment is fully cut over as of this morning. Legacy price tables in Tollgate are read-only; all ticket quotes now flow through the experiment engine. Variant split is 70/30, guardrail metrics green for 48 hours. Rollback path stays live until Friday, then we delete the shadow writes. No incidents during the switch; two minor cache warm-up blips, self-resolved. Nothing pending on your side except sign-off. For the record, the production configuration after cut-over is below.

deployment values, yadug-bawif:
[framir]
team = pelox
access_code = ac_a38ab2
owner = tamion.julael
host = framir.tolvaqlabs.test
port = 11211
peer = tammir.zemvargrid.local
salt = 2215ef03
pin = 1541

Before we cut the release, please look closely at the unlock timing in the Tumblecrest locker flow. The current code opens the latch relay before confirming the member's reservation write has committed, which leaves a short window where two residents could claim the same locker. I've reordered the calls and added a grace timeout, but the timeout values interact with the latch hardware's debounce. The constants I settled on are these.

tuning table, kajog-bawip:
TIERS = {
    "kelius": 256,
    "lammir": 543,
}